Frequently Asked Questions about Studio Piedmont Park Apartments
What is the Cheapest apartment in Piedmont Park with Studio?
Currently the most affordable Studio in Piedmont Park is at Crest on Peachtree listed at $899.
How much is the average rent for a Studio Piedmont Park Apartment?
The average rent for a Studio Apartment in Piedmont Park is $1,781.
What is the largest available Studio Piedmont Park Apartment for rent?
Today's apartment with the most square footage in Piedmont Park is a 881 square feet unit starting from $1,890 at Atlantic House.
What is the average size for Piedmont Park Studio Apartments for rent?
The average size for a Studio rental in Piedmont Park is currently 547 sq ft.
